I'm obsessing over a new wallet. I've pretty much always had black, brown, tan colors. I'm thinking cream color would be neutral and go with everything. But would I have to be cleaning it all the time? I saw a nice Marc by Marc Jacobs one yesterday but I don't know if I want to spend $200 on something that will get trashed. Maybe better to get something less expensive if I want a really light color. Anyone have a wallet this color in soft leather? Is it a pain to take care of?:confused1:
 
I love white and cream bags, but I'd have too much trouble keeping a wallet clean. The bags are enough work!! Also, I don't spend a lot on white accessories because I don't want to freak out over every little spot. I do have a Tod's in light tan, but I don't use it a lot and obsess over cleaning the corners after every use and before putting it away.
 
Personally, I've carried either white or pastel colored wallets for years and I've never had any problems. I found it pretty easy to keep them clean, since the wallet is inside your bag it's kinda protected. The only problem could be color transfer from the lining of your bag, but that depends on the bag you use. But that's just my experience...

You must have a very clean purse lol! I'm super messy and careless my purse has some random things and its cluttered so for me its the opposite since the wallet is in my bag its prone to more scratches and scuffs from my other items in the bag. I have a gucci britt wallet that has been through a war in my bag lol! It has a lot of minor scuffs/scratches on it but it doesn't make any sense for me to carry it in a dustbag inside my purse to protect it although I know one person who does :shocked: its bizarre anyways and you have to know that since its a wallet your hand oils will be all over it too thats why I stick to dark I can't imagine what it will look like if my wallet was white and I don't think I would want to. I have a white bal city and I have to really treat her otherwise she will be so messed up and nasty. Plus with the white I'm seriously constantly inspecting it to make sure nothing got on it :sad:
 
I just thought of something else as well - a wallet is something you "handle" a lot more - I have to touch it a lot more than I have to touch my bag, so in my mind that makes it worse.
 
I think that I would probably get a cheaper white or cream colored leather wallet, like Mundi or...why can't I think of another one right now....but anyhow, you can go to your local Department store and get one for about $30 or $40, and not invest so much in it, just to test drive it to see how it holds up.
